Venting a dryer outside requires a clear, unobstructed path. Use rigid metal ducting (max 35 feet) rather than flexible vinyl, secure joints with metal foil tape (not duct tape), and terminate with a louvered exterior hood with a backdraft damper to prevent pests and outside air from entering.

From 19 January 2027, vented, condenser, and gas-fired tumble dryers can no longer be sold as new products in Great Britain. Only heat pump tumble dryers meeting the new minimum energy performance standard will be permitted for sale.
A ventless dryer is a space-saving, energy-efficient appliance that does not require an external exhaust duct. It recycles air through the drum and removes moisture via condensation or a heat pump, making it ideal for apartments, closets, or homes without venting capabilities.
Use rigid smooth metal ducting (aluminum or galvanized steel) for the main vent run inside your walls. For the short connection from the dryer to the wall, use a semi-rigid aluminum transition duct. Avoid flexible foil, vinyl, or plastic hoses, as they trap lint and are significant fire hazards.

Gas dryers must always be vented outdoors to exhaust poisonous carbon monoxide and moisture. Electric dryers can be ventless (condenser or heat pump), but traditional electric dryers must vent outside to prevent dangerous mold growth and lint buildup in your home.

Statistics reveal just how prevalent — and dangerous — dryer fires can be. According to the U.S. Fire Administration (USFA) and the National Fire Protection Association (NFPA), around 2,900 home clothes dryer fires are reported each year in the United States.

Instead of exhausting hot, moist air outdoors, a ventless dryer traps the moisture, cools it into water, and disposes of it in one of two ways: it collects the water in a removable drawer (or reservoir) that you empty manually, or pumps it straight out through a drain hose into your plumbing.
